This page compares Doubao Lite 1.5 (ByteDance) and Grok 4 (xAI) using the latest snapshots we have as of Aug 1, 2026. On preference Elo, Grok 4 is ahead by 128 points (1,488 vs 1,360; seed-bootstrap (Aug 1, 2026)). On SWE-bench coding, Grok 4 resolves 58.6% versus 46% (seed-bootstrap (Aug 1, 2026)). Doubao Lite 1.5 streams faster (180 tok/s) while Doubao Lite 1.5 is the cheaper output token ($0.1/1M). Grok 4 has the larger context window (256k tokens). Every cell below is a dated snapshot from a named public source — we do not invent missing scores, and we do not run SWE-bench ourselves.

| Target Workload | Recommended Pick | Evaluation Rationale |
|---|---|---|
| Repo / coding agents | Grok 4 | Higher SWE-bench (58.6%). |
| High-volume chat | Doubao Lite 1.5 | Lower output list price ($0.1/1M). |
| Voice / low-latency UI | Doubao Lite 1.5 | Lower TTFT (110 ms). |
| Long-document RAG | Grok 4 | Larger window (256k). |
| Screenshots / vision | Grok 4 | Grok 4 is the side marked multimodal in the catalog. |
